## What is the Forecast of Options Trading Forecasting?

Options trading forecasting, within the cryptocurrency context, involves leveraging statistical models and machine learning techniques to predict future price movements of crypto derivatives, particularly options. This process extends beyond simple time series analysis, incorporating factors unique to crypto markets such as regulatory shifts, technological advancements, and on-chain data. Accurate forecasting requires a deep understanding of option pricing models like Black-Scholes and its adaptations, alongside an awareness of the impact of volatility surfaces and implied volatility skew. Ultimately, the goal is to inform trading strategies, manage risk exposure, and optimize portfolio construction in this dynamic asset class.

## What is the Algorithm of Options Trading Forecasting?

The core of options trading forecasting often relies on sophisticated algorithms, frequently employing recurrent neural networks (RNNs) or transformer models to capture temporal dependencies in price data. These algorithms are trained on historical price series, order book data, and sentiment analysis derived from social media or news sources. Backtesting these models against historical data is crucial to evaluate their predictive power and identify potential biases. Furthermore, incorporating techniques like ensemble methods and regularization helps to mitigate overfitting and improve the robustness of the forecasting algorithm.

## What is the Risk of Options Trading Forecasting?

Options trading forecasting inherently involves assessing and managing risk, particularly given the leveraged nature of derivatives. Model risk, stemming from inaccuracies in the forecasting algorithm, is a primary concern, necessitating rigorous validation and stress testing. Market risk, driven by unforeseen events or shifts in investor sentiment, can significantly impact option prices, requiring dynamic adjustments to trading strategies. Effective risk management also involves understanding and mitigating counterparty risk, especially when trading over-the-counter (OTC) options, and employing hedging techniques to protect against adverse price movements.
